UPDATE: October 26, 2017
Effective December 17, 2017 the SPG partnership with Uber will come to an end.
Members who have met all of the requirements to earn Starpoints in accordance with the SPG-Uber benefits program, including, without limitation, having a Stay posted to their SPG Member account for the current calendar year will continue to earn Starpoints on Uber rides up until 11:59PM on December 17, 2017.
If the stay overlaps with the program end date, you will still earn 2 starpoints per USD 1 spent on Uber rides taken during your stay. Any rides taken after 11:59 on December 17, 2017 even if taken during a stay that originated on or before December 17, 2014 will not earn starpoints on that uber ride.
Frequently Asked Questions
When will members stop earning Starpoints on their Uber rides?
Members who have met all of the requirements to earn Starpoints in accordance with the SPG-Uber benefits program, including, without limitation, having a Stay posted to their SPG Member account for the current calendar year will continue to earn Starpoints on Uber rides up until 11:59PM on December 17, 2017, subject to applicable limits.
If members have a stay that overlaps with the program end date, will they still earn 2 Starpoints per US$1 spent on Uber rides taken during the stay?
Yes, members who check-in for a Stay prior to 11:59PM on December 17, 2017 and have an Uber pick-up time prior to 11:59PM on December 17, 2017, subject to applicable limits, will earn 2 Starpoints for every U.S. dollar or its foreign equivalent denomination spent for fares on the Uber ride(s). Any rides taken after 11:59PM on December 17, 2017, even if taken during a stay that originated on or prior to December 17, 2017, will not earn Starpoints on the Uber ride(s). To earn Starpoints for any Uber ride the member must have met all of the requirements to earn Starpoints in accordance with the SPG-Uber benefits program, including, without limitation, having a Stay posted to their SPG Member account for the current calendar year.
Why did I recently have a delay in my Starpoints posting for my Uber rides?
An issue was identified affecting Uber rides over the last month that delayed the posting of points to member accounts. We have since fixed this issue and members should receive all ride credits within the stated 2-4 week period.
UPDATE: January 18, 2017
Uber Partnership Update
With your SPG and Uber accounts linked and you have met a requirement of ONE qualifying stay in the current calendar year, SPG members will earn 1 point per dollar spent with Uber on every day rides. For rides during stays, SPG members will earn 2 points per dollar spent on Uber (Preferred), 3 points per (Gold or Platinum), or 4 points per (Plat75).
There is a maximum of $10,000 in points-earning spend with Uber per calendar year. This means that you could have up to 40,000 SPG points with this promotion (if you were a Plat75 and only used Uber while on SPG stays and maxed out $10,000 in Uber services).
